Top 5 Battlefield Commander Games Performance in Romania Q3 2023
In Q3 2023, the top Battlefield Commander games in Romania showed varying trends in weekly downloads, revenue, and active users. Sensor Tower data reveals the detailed performance metrics.
In Q3 2023, the performance of top Battlefield Commander games on a unified platform in Romania showcased interesting trends. According to Sensor Tower data, here’s a closer look at the weekly downloads, revenue, and active users for each game.
Clash Royale from Supercell experienced notable fluctuations in weekly revenue, peaking at around $17.6K in the week of August 7 and $16.2K in the week of September 4. Weekly downloads showed an upward trend, reaching approximately 5.9K by the end of September. Its weekly active users also saw significant growth, increasing from about 305K at the start of the quarter to over 408K by the end of September.
War Eternal by ONEMT had a consistent but modest weekly revenue, peaking at $3.2K in mid-July. The game’s weekly active users decreased from around 136 at the beginning of the quarter to 83 by the end of September.
Might & Magic: Era of Chaos from Ubisoft showed a steady increase in weekly revenue mid-quarter, reaching nearly $2K in mid-August. The game’s weekly downloads were minimal, peaking at 58 in mid-August. Weekly active users remained relatively stable, fluctuating around the mid-90s by the end of the quarter.
TFT: Teamfight Tactics by Riot Games had a peak weekly revenue of around $2K in mid-September. Weekly downloads saw a downward trend, dropping to around 306 by the end of September. The game’s weekly active users remained fairly stable, averaging around 9.3K throughout the quarter.
Art of War: Legions from Fastone Games had a peak weekly revenue of approximately $1.7K at the end of September, with a relatively low but steady number of weekly downloads, peaking at 307 in mid-July. Its weekly active users saw a decrease from about 1.3K at the beginning of the quarter to 646 by the end of September.
